NGG.wine: Debut of New Generation Georgian Wines at ProWein Tokyo 2026

On April 15th, Tokyo hosts the ProWein 2026 international exhibition, where Georgian winemaking will be presented with a revolutionary concept. Innovative brands are united for the Asian market by NGG.wine (New Generation Georgian Wine) — a new strategic platform co-founded by HIT Hub and Vine & Wine Group (vwg.ge).

This marks the first practical implementation of HIT Hub's long-term, public strategy, which was announced back in 2025 in an interview with OK! Magazine, where the company's founders discussed their plans for "collaborative integration" in the wine sector.

Vision into Reality

NGG.wine is not just another producer association; it is a response to global market challenges. At the Tokyo exhibition, member wineries are represented under the NGG.wine umbrella: Vine Cra, Royal Ikalto, Avaliani Brothers, Binekhi Winery, and Gurgenidze Family Winery, who are creating the "new generation" of Georgian wine.
